Determine the permissible end thrust

Assignment Help Physics
Reference no: EM13961833

A solid shaft 125mm did transmits 600kW at 300 revolutions/minute. It is also subjected to a bending moment of 9kN-m and to an end thrust. If the maximum principal stress is limited to 80MPa, determine the permissible end thrust.

Also, determine the position in which the principal stress acts, and draw a diagram showing the position of the plane relative to the torque, and the plane of the bending moment applied to the shaft.
